I am trying to use PhpUnit with Composer. In this purpose I did:
1 Added phpunit to req composer section:
"require": { "php": ">=5.3.0" }, "require-dev": { "phpunit/phpunit": "3.7.*" }, "autoload": { "psr-0": {"PhpProject": "src/"} }
2 Installed what needed:
php composer.phar install –dev
Operation finished with success.
Installing phpunit/phpunit (3.7.6)
Downloading: 100%
Unfortunately when I want to run the tests, I get
./vendor/bin/phpunit PHP Fatal error: Call to a member function
add() on a non-object in /home/serek/php/project/tests/bootstrap.php
on line 12
Problem occurs because
return ComposerAutoloaderInit::getLoader(); in vendor/autoload returns NULL into test bootstrap.
Any idea how can it be solved without hacking Loader?

tests/bootstrap.php (here I need only autoloader)
> $loader = require_once __DIR__ . "/../vendor/autoload.php";
> $loader->add('PhpProject\\', __DIR__); //<- this is problematic line 12 (comments has 9 lines)
/../vendor/autoload.php
// autoload.php generated by Composer
require_once __DIR__ . '/composer' . '/autoload_real.php';
return ComposerAutoloaderInit::getLoader();
The issue is that PHPUnit already requires the autoload file, so your require_once call is not executed and therefore the return value is not set (php doesn’t keep the return value of require calls so require_once breaks on that use case).
You can safely change it to a
requirebecause with recent composer versions the autoloader is not created twice anymore and requiring it many times just returns you the same instance every time.
